đĽ Recipe: Peach BBQ Sauce
Ingredients:
- 1 cup very ripe peaches, peeled and smashed or pureed
â OR â ½ cup peach preserves if fresh peaches arenât available
- ½ cup ketchup
- 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
- 3 tablespoons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on Black Beardâs Smoke (our spicy, smoky Cajun blend)
Instructions:
Add all ingredients to a saucepan over medium heat. Stir and bring to a gentle simmer. Let it cook down until slightly thickenedâthis usually takes about 10â15 minutes.
If it gets too thick, add a tablespoon of water and stir. Repeat as needed.
This sauce is perfect on grilled chicken, pork chops, shrimp, or even brushed on salmon just before serving.
